Conditional Lien Release

1. Parties: Identification of the lien holder (typically contractor/subcontractor) and the property owner or prime contractor
2. Background: Brief description of the original contract, work performed, and circumstances leading to the lien
3. Definitions: Key terms used throughout the document including 'Project', 'Property', 'Contract', 'Lien Amount', and 'Conditional Payment'
4. Property Description: Legal description of the property subject to the lien
5. Original Lien Details: Information about the original lien including amount, date filed, and registration details
6. Conditional Release Terms: Specific conditions that must be met for the release to become effective
7. Payment Details: Specification of the payment amount and method that will trigger the release
8. Release Effect: Description of what rights are being released upon satisfaction of conditions
9. Warranties and Representations: Statements confirming the lien holder's authority to release the lien and other standard warranties
10. Governing Law: Confirmation that Irish law governs the release
11. Execution: Signature blocks and execution requirements
1. Partial Release Provisions: Used when the release covers only a portion of the total lien amount
2. Multiple Payment Phases: Required when the release is tied to multiple payment installments
3. Subordinate Liens: Needed when dealing with multiple tiers of contractors and related liens
4. Dispute Resolution: Include when parties want to specify process for resolving disputes about release conditions
5. Notice Requirements: Additional notice provisions for complex projects or multiple parties
6. Retention Rights: Used when certain rights are being retained despite the release
7. Third Party Rights: Required when the release affects rights of third parties
1. Schedule A - Property Details: Detailed legal description of the property and relevant title information
2. Schedule B - Payment Schedule: Detailed breakdown of payment amounts and timing if multiple payments are involved
3. Schedule C - Original Lien Documentation: Copies of original lien filing and registration documents
4. Schedule D - Project Summary: Details of the work performed and contract reference information
5. Appendix 1 - Supporting Documents: Copies of relevant certificates, permits, or other supporting documentation
6. Appendix 2 - Certification Forms: Standard forms required for lien release under Irish law
